Lime is not just a zesty addition to your sweet peach salsa; it also brings a wealth of nutritional benefits. One of the most significant contributions of lime is its high vitamin C content. This essential vitamin plays a crucial role in boosting the immune system, promoting healthy skin, and aiding in the absorption of iron from plant-based foods. A single lime can provide approximately 20% of the recommended daily intake of vitamin C, making it a smart choice for enhancing not only the flavor of your salsa but also your overall health.

Sweet Peach Salsa

Discover the deliciousness of sweet peach salsa, a refreshing twist on a classic recipe that highlights the vibrant flavors of summer. This fruit-based salsa combines juicy, ripe peaches with the heat of jalapeños and the zesty punch of lime juice, creating a delightful balance of sweet and savory. Ideal as a dip, topping for grilled meats, or a side dish for tacos, it's a versatile addition to any meal. Embrace seasonal ingredients and elevate your culinary creations with this flavorful dish!

Ingredients
  

2 ripe peaches, diced

1 small red onion, finely chopped

1 medium jalapeño, seeded and minced (adjust for spiciness)

1/4 cup fresh cilantro, chopped

1 lime, juiced

1 tablespoon honey or agave syrup (optional for extra sweetness)

1/4 teaspoon sea salt

1/4 teaspoon black pepper

Instructions
 

Start by washing the peaches thoroughly. Cut them in half, remove the pit, and then dice the flesh into small pieces. Place them in a medium mixing bowl.

    Finely chop the red onion and add it to the bowl with the diced peaches.

      Carefully seed the jalapeño (to reduce spiciness) and mince it. Add it to the mixing bowl for an extra zing.

        Chop the fresh cilantro and add to the mixture for an aromatic touch.

          Squeeze the lime and pour the juice over the salsa ingredients, ensuring you capture all the juices.

            If you prefer your salsa a little sweeter, drizzle in honey or agave syrup. Season with salt and pepper.

              Gently mix all the ingredients using a spatula or spoon. Avoid bruising the peaches too much to retain some texture.

                Let the salsa sit for at least 15-20 minutes at room temperature before serving. This allows the flavors to meld beautifully.

                  Taste and adjust seasoning if needed — add more lime juice, honey, or seasoning according to your preference.

                    Prep Time, Total Time, Servings: 10 minutes | 30 minutes (including resting time) | 4 servings
